What is Electric Tractors Market?


Electric tractors are innovative agricultural vehicles powered by electric motors instead of traditional internal combustion engines. These tractors offer benefits like reduced emissions, lower operating costs, and quieter operation. Key drivers of this market include technological advancements, such as improved battery technologies and increased efficiency, making electric tractors more viable for farmers. Regulatory changes promoting sustainable farming practices and emissions reductions further fuel market growth. Economic trends, including rising fuel prices, also encourage adoption as electric solutions become more cost-effective.

However, challenges exist, such as limited charging infrastructure and higher initial purchase costs compared to conventional tractors, which could hinder widespread adoption. **John Deere** stands as a leading player, holding a substantial market share. The company reported revenues of approximately $47 billion in 2022, with an increasing focus on electric machinery. Recent innovations include their autonomous electric tractors, showcasing a commitment to sustainability and efficiency.

**AGCO GmbH**, known for its innovative agricultural solutions, has also entered the electric tractor market. Their Fendt brand is developing electric models, with market growth reflecting a broader strategy to enhance efficiency and reduce emissions. The company’s sales revenue reached about $10 billion in 2022, indicating a strong position in the agricultural sector.
